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
142 75501 54309739605 08
2387071 21649891811
2387071 21649891811
062196438 445994230 4015000666
All about undefined
Interested in learning more?
2387071 21649891811
062196438 445994230 4015000666
See more
967 762076148 6970455412
55455177172 2444 596
See more
1768504 040158833 53882744480
3057 7647638 0544276 772 84
See more